WebJun 15, 2024 · Private foundations typically have a single major source of funding (usually gifts from one family or corporation rather than funding from many sources) and most have as their primary activity the making of grants to other charitable organizations and to individuals, rather than the direct operation of charitable programs. WebThe credit is equal to 25 percent of the qualified investment made by the taxpayer during the taxable year. This credit is available to pass-through entities, such as members of partnerships and S corporations. The credit is nonrefundable and cannot be carried back. You may carry forward any excess credit to the next tax year.
